This cute pendant used to be a Norwegian demitasse spoon! It is made from sterling silver, and features transparent purple glass enamel over a shell pattern on the back of the bowl. The type of enameling is called Guilloche (Ghee-oh-SHAY), where artists engrave a precise pattern into the metal before applying the enamel.
To make the pendant, I cut the bowl and handle off the spoon, grind and polish the cut edge smooth and then carefully bend the shank to create a bail.
